Our newest opportunity is for a talented Senior Quantity Surveyor Manager to join our client in Jeddah.
This position is responsible for implementing cost controls and financial control procedures as outlined in the construction contracts. Other responsibilities will include; measure and assess the client’s variations to the construction works and contractor’s claims for changes, evaluate contractor’s monthly interim payment applications and identify areas of concern and assess their potential impact upon the project budget.
We envisage success in this role to include;
Lead and manage all quantity surveying and commercial activities under the PMC scope of services.
Establish and maintain project cost plans, budgets, and cash flows for infrastructure and vertical development packages.
Oversee cost control, forecasting, and reporting to ensure alignment with approved budgets and client objectives.
Manage procurement strategies, tender evaluations, contract awards, and commercial negotiations in coordination with the PMC team.
Administer contracts, including variations, claims, change management, and final accounts.
Provide strategic commercial advice to the client and project leadership, supporting informed decision-making.
Coordinate closely with design, project management, and construction teams to manage cost impacts arising from design development and programme changes.
Support client reporting, commercial reviews, and governance processes.
Lead, mentor, and manage QS and commercial team members across the project.
